CICERO, N.Y. (WSYR-TV) — It’s a picture for the history books, taken after the Cicero Police Department’s first all-female midnight shift.
It wasn’t intentional—the three officers, Sgt. Ashley Smith, Officer Austin Ray-Briggmin, and Officer Gabrielle Morrissey responded to a call and, once it wrapped up, realized it was a historic moment.
“Wait a minute, this is the first time that we’ve ever had an all-girls squad on midnights and ever actually in the history of our department,” Sgt. Smith said.
The achievement was posted on the department’s Facebook page, and it immediately gained traction, receiving thousands of comments and hundreds of shares. Some people were supportive, others not so much…
